Python绘图加上网格教程

1. 整体流程

首先我们来看一下整个实现“Python绘图加上网格”的流程,可以使用以下表格展示:

步骤 操作
1 安装绘图库matplotlib
2 导入matplotlib库
3 创建绘图窗口
4 绘制图形
5 添加网格线
6 显示图形

2. 操作步骤

步骤1:安装绘图库matplotlib

在终端或命令行中输入以下命令安装matplotlib库:

pip install matplotlib

步骤2:导入matplotlib库

在Python文件开头导入matplotlib库:

import matplotlib.pyplot as plt

步骤3:创建绘图窗口

fig, ax = plt.subplots()

步骤4:绘制图形

根据需求绘制图形,例如绘制一条直线:

plt.plot([1, 2, 3, 4], [1, 4, 9, 16])

步骤5:添加网格线

plt.grid(True)

步骤6:显示图形

plt.show()

3. 代码解释

  • plt.subplots(): 创建一个新的Figure对象和一个新的axes对象。Figure对象可以包含多个子图(axes),可以通过ax来操作当前的axes对象。
  • plt.plot(): 绘制图形,第一个参数是x轴数据,第二个参数是y轴数据。
  • plt.grid(True): 添加网格线,True表示显示网格线。
  • plt.show(): 显示绘制的图形。

4. 状态图

stateDiagram
    [*] --> 创建窗口
    创建窗口 --> 绘制图形
    绘制图形 --> 添加网格线
    添加网格线 --> 显示图形
    显示图形 --> [*]

5. 序列图

sequenceDiagram
    小白->>你: 请求学习Python绘图加上网格
    你->>小白: 安装matplotlib库
    你->>小白: 导入matplotlib库
    你->>小白: 创建绘图窗口
    你->>小白: 绘制图形
    你->>小白: 添加网格线
    你->>小白: 显示图形
    小白->>你: 学习完成

结尾

通过本教程,你已经学会了如何在Python中绘制图形并添加网格线。希本这对你有所帮助,继续加油学习吧!如果有任何疑问,欢迎随时向我提问。祝你编程路上一帆风顺!